# Learning That Feels Like a Game — But Works Like a Curriculum ### How Jogg's Gamified System Turns AI/ML Mastery Into a Journey You Actually Want to Take *by the Jogg Team | MokingBird Oy* --- Let's be honest about something uncomfortable: most people who start learning AI/ML do not finish. They open a textbook, stare at the first chapter on linear algebra, and close it. They start an online course, watch the first five lectures with genuine enthusiasm, and abandon it by week three when life gets busy. They install PyTorch, run the first tutorial, and then… nothing. The momentum dies. This is not a motivation problem. It is a *system* problem. Traditional learning formats were not designed to compete with everything else competing for your attention — and they were certainly not designed to make the long, slow grind of building genuine expertise feel satisfying along the way. Jogg was. Here is how. --- ## The Psychology Behind Jogg's Design The gamification in Jogg is not decoration. It is grounded in real research on motivation, habit formation, and learning retention. ### The Progress Principle Harvard Business School researcher Teresa Amabile identified what she called the "progress principle": the single biggest driver of motivation in complex cognitive work is making visible progress toward a meaningful goal. When you can see yourself moving forward — however incrementally — you feel motivated to continue. Jogg makes progress visible at every level: - Per-question: you see immediate feedback on whether you were right and why - Per-session: you see XP earned, questions answered, accuracy rate - Per-lane: you see your mastery percentage grow toward 100% - Per-day: you see your streak count and daily contribution - Per-lifetime: you see your level, tier, and cumulative progression toward Mythril There is always something to make progress on. There is always a number moving in the right direction. ### Variable Reward and Productive Challenge Games are engaging partly because they use **variable reward** — you don't always know exactly what you'll get. In Jogg, you don't know in advance whether the next question will be straightforward or whether it will be a genuinely tricky expert-level question that makes you think harder than you expected. That variability keeps engagement high. At the same time, Jogg's adaptive difficulty ensures that challenge stays in the "productive" zone — hard enough to be meaningful, not so hard that it becomes frustrating. Psychologist Mihaly Csikszentmihalyi called this the "flow state" — the optimal experience where skill and challenge are balanced. --- ## The Full Gamification System — Every Feature Explained ### The 50-Level Progression System Jogg uses a 50-level mastery scale instead of the more common "beginner → intermediate → advanced" three-step classification. Why 50? Because real learning is not three jumps. It is a continuous progression with dozens of meaningful milestones. When you go from level 11 to level 12, you have genuinely done more work than the previous level required, and you can feel it. The 50 levels are organized into four tiers, each representing a meaningfully different stage of AI/ML expertise: **Bronze (Levels 1–12): The Foundation Builder** You are building your fundamentals. You know ML basics, you can work with data, you understand core concepts. This is where most new learners spend their first few months — and every level gained here represents real knowledge solidified. What Bronze feels like: "I understand what a neural network is and why it works. I know the difference between supervised and unsupervised learning. I've answered questions about gradient descent that actually required me to think." **Steel (Levels 13–24): The Practitioner** You have a working knowledge of the full AI/ML pipeline — from data acquisition through preprocessing, model training, and deployment. You can have real technical conversations. You understand the tradeoffs. What Steel feels like: "I understand why people use Adam over SGD in most cases, but also when SGD might be preferable. I know what attention is and how multi-head attention works. I can explain what quantization means and why it matters." **Platinum (Levels 25–36): The Deep Practitioner** You are now operating at a professional level. You understand research concepts, production challenges, and the nuances that separate people who have used AI tools from people who understand them. What Platinum feels like: "I know what RAG is, how vector databases work, why KV caching matters for inference latency, and what the tradeoffs are in choosing between full fine-tuning and LoRA. I can read research papers and understand the key contributions." **Mythril (Levels 37–50): The Master** This is the domain of the genuinely expert. The questions at this tier test knowledge that most practitioners never encounter — edge cases, research-level nuances, the "why" behind architectural choices that most engineers take for granted. What Mythril feels like: "I can discuss scaling laws and their implications for compute budgets. I understand constitutional AI and the theoretical basis for RLHF. I can explain why FlashAttention is IO-bound rather than compute-bound and what that means practically." The level curve is progressive — each level requires more XP than the last, reflecting the reality that depth is harder to acquire than breadth. --- ### XP — The Fuel of Progress Every correct answer earns you XP (experience points). Not just any amount — the XP you earn reflects the actual difficulty and conditions of your answer. **Difficulty Base XP:** | Level | XP | |-------|----| | Beginner | 10 XP | | Intermediate | 20 XP | | Advanced | 35 XP | | Expert | 50 XP | **Speed Bonus:** Jogg rewards not just knowing the answer, but knowing it quickly — the kind of fluency that comes from genuine internalization rather than slow deliberation. If you answer faster than the expected time for a question of that difficulty, you earn a time bonus multiplier up to 1.5×. This reflects a real principle from learning science: fluency matters. Experts don't just know the right answer — they access it quickly because the underlying concepts are deeply encoded. The speed bonus in Jogg rewards and incentivizes that fluency. **Mode Context:** Different learning modes have different purposes and intensities. Some modes carry additional multipliers to reflect their higher challenge or strategic value. **The Result:** Each question session produces a concrete XP number that honestly reflects how you performed — not just whether you got things right, but how confidently and quickly you demonstrated mastery. --- ### Streaks — The Power of Consistency One of the most research-supported findings in habit science is this: **consistency beats intensity**. 30 minutes every day for a month produces better learning outcomes than 10 hours in a single weekend, even when the total time is equal. Jogg's streak system is designed around this insight. Every day you complete at least one quiz session — including Daily Jogg — your streak grows by one. Miss a day, and your streak resets. It sounds simple, and it is. But the psychology is powerful. **What streaks do:** - They create a commitment mechanism — you don't want to break a 14-day streak - They make "just a few questions today" feel meaningful, because maintaining a streak is worth something - They normalize daily learning as a habit, not an event - They give you a visible measure of consistency to feel proud of The streak flame icon in Jogg burns brighter as your streak grows. At high streaks, it becomes a real badge of commitment — not just to the app, but to your own learning goals. --- ### Daily Jogg — The Science of Remembering Daily Jogg is not just a daily quiz. It is powered by **FSRS (Free Spaced Repetition Scheduler)**, one of the most advanced spaced repetition algorithms available. Spaced repetition is one of the most well-established findings in learning science. The basic idea: you remember things better when you review them at increasing intervals, just before you are about to forget them. This is far more efficient than massed practice (cramming). FSRS improves on older spaced repetition algorithms (like SM-2, used by Anki) by more accurately modeling individual forgetting curves. It adjusts review timing based on: - How difficult the question is for you specifically - How well you answered it in previous reviews - How long it has been since your last review The result: Daily Jogg presents you with exactly the questions you need to see today — not too early (wasteful), not too late (already forgotten). It typically takes 5–10 minutes per day, which is all the time you need when the algorithm ensures every minute is maximally productive. **Daily Jogg XP is handled specially:** If you retry Daily Jogg on the same day, Jogg uses a delta model — it only adds the XP improvement over your previous attempt, preventing inflation while still rewarding genuine improvement. --- ### Lane Mastery and Certificates Jogg's 9 learning lanes are not just organizational categories — they are genuine learning milestones with unlocking mechanics that reinforce the curriculum logic. **Progressive Unlocking:** Lane 0 (Foundations) is available to everyone immediately. Each subsequent lane requires **80% mastery** of the previous lane before it unlocks. This is not an arbitrary barrier — it reflects a real pedagogical principle: some knowledge genuinely depends on other knowledge. You cannot meaningfully learn about transformer training (Lane 3) if you don't understand what a neural network is (Lane 0) or how data flows into a model (Lanes 1–2). The unlock system enforces productive sequencing. **Mastery Percentage:** Your mastery percentage in each lane is computed from your performance on that lane's questions — not just whether you answered them, but how consistently and confidently you answer them. A question you got wrong three times and then finally got right contributes differently to your mastery score than a question you nailed immediately. **Certificates:** Complete a lane and earn a **verifiable certificate** from MokingBird Oy / Sortify. Your certificate shows: - Your name (as set in your profile) - The lane completed - The date of completion - A unique verification code Certificates are verifiable at jogg.app, shareable, and represent a genuine milestone in your learning journey. --- ### Papers Quest — Depth as a Game Mechanic Papers Quest is Jogg's most unique learning mode, and it works differently from standard quiz modes. Instead of questions organized by lane or topic, Papers Quest presents you with questions organized by research paper. Each paper has its own set of questions, and you can see your completion and accuracy for each paper individually. **What makes Papers Quest feel like a game:** - Each paper is a self-contained challenge — you can "complete" a paper and see your score - Papers have difficulty ratings (Beginner → Expert), creating a natural progression - The citation network between papers creates interesting chains — mastering "Attention Is All You Need" unlocks richer understanding of BERT, which enriches GPT-3, which enriches InstructGPT - Paper completion badges track your progress through the literature **What makes it educational:** Unlike trivia games, Papers Quest questions are not about surface facts. They test genuine conceptual understanding — the kind of knowledge that stays with you because it connects to a web of related ideas. --- ### RUSH Mode — When Speed Is the Lesson RUSH Mode is Jogg's speed challenge — questions under time pressure, with higher XP rewards for fast accurate answers. RUSH Mode serves a real educational function beyond entertainment. It trains: - **Automaticity** — the ability to recall correct answers without conscious deliberation - **Confidence calibration** — knowing what you actually know versus what you only think you know - **Exam performance** — time pressure is a real feature of technical interviews and exams If you find that your RUSH Mode performance lags significantly behind your normal quiz performance, it tells you something important: you have understanding, but not yet fluency. You know things when you have time to think about them, but you have not yet internalized them deeply enough to access them quickly. That gap is real and worth working on. RUSH Mode makes it visible. --- ### Arcade Mode — Challenge and Competition Arcade mode brings a competitive edge to Jogg's learning experience. It is structured as an intensive challenge run — a set of questions where you need to hit a pass mark to succeed. In Arcade mode: - The stakes are higher — not reaching the pass mark means no XP reward for the run - The questions may come from any lane and any difficulty - Completion of a successful Arcade run earns a bonus reward Arcade mode is for learners who have built confidence in their knowledge and want to test themselves under pressure — and for those competitive moments when you want to push your performance to the limit. --- ### Custom Quizzes and Sharing Jogg lets you create your own quiz from a selected set of questions, then share it with anyone using a 6-character code or a QR code. **Why this matters for learning:** Creating a quiz is itself a learning activity. Deciding which questions represent the most important concepts in a topic — and organizing them into a coherent set — forces active engagement with the material. It is the "teaching it back" principle made interactive. **Why this matters for community:** Shared quizzes create a social learning dynamic. Study groups can create shared quiz sets. Professors can create curated question sets for their students. Friends can challenge each other. The 6-character code makes sharing effortless — just share the code and anyone with Jogg can join. --- ## Putting It All Together: A Day in the Life with Jogg Here is what a productive day with Jogg actually looks like for a working professional learning AI/ML in parallel with their job: **Morning (5 minutes):** Open Jogg. Daily Jogg has 7 questions ready based on your spaced repetition schedule. You answer them — 5 correct, 2 wrong. You get 85 XP. Streak maintained. Day started right. **Lunch break (10 minutes):** You are working through Lane 3 (Model Training). You answer 12 questions on transformer architectures. You get 10 of 12 right. Lane mastery goes from 67% to 71%. 180 XP earned. One level-up notification. **Evening (20 minutes):** You have been meaning to properly understand LoRA for a project. You open Papers Quest and work through the LoRA paper questions. 15 questions, 12 correct. You understand low-rank adaptation at a deeper level than you did this morning. **End of day:** 110 XP from daily, 180 from lane practice, 145 from Papers Quest = 435 XP today. Streak is now 8 days. Lane 3 mastery is 71%. You are on track to unlock Lane 4 within the week. That is a genuinely productive day of AI/ML learning — and it fit inside the gaps of a full work day. --- ## Why This Approach Beats Traditional Learning | Traditional Learning | Jogg | |---------------------|------| | No feedback until the end of a chapter/course | Immediate per-question feedback | | Unclear how far you are from "done" | Visible mastery percentage at all times | | Easy to skip days without consequence | Streak system makes consistency visible | | All topics weighted equally | Adaptive difficulty focuses on your weak spots | | Passive reading → poor retention | Active recall → significantly better retention | | No connection to primary literature | Papers Quest and Paper Request features | | Progress resets if you switch platforms | Your data belongs to you and stays with you | --- ## The Philosophy: Gamification in Service of Mastery Jogg's gamification is not about keeping you hooked for its own sake. There are no dark patterns, no artificial urgency, no manipulative mechanics designed to extract more time from you than your learning warrants. Every gamification element in Jogg exists because it supports genuine learning: - Streaks exist because consistency is how real learning happens - XP exists because visible progress sustains motivation - Levels and tiers exist because milestones give achievement meaning - Certificates exist because completion deserves recognition - Lane unlocks exist because knowledge genuinely builds on knowledge - Papers Quest exists because the research literature is where the real understanding lives The goal is not to maximize time in the app. The goal is to maximize genuine understanding of AI/ML — and to make the process of getting there engaging enough that you actually stick with it long enough for it to matter. That is what great gamified learning looks like. --- *Ready to start your AI/ML journey? Download Jogg on iOS or Android.* *Jogg — Your Professional AI/ML App.*
Jogg Blog